My issue with Otamendi and that first goal is that he doesn't either win the ball or commit the foul.

Naturally, if going to ground, then I'd much prefer him to win the fucking ball but if he can't do that then he has to commit the foul.

Do something, don't just dive in and tackle fresh air. That leaves us exposed and had he made the foul wolves don't score that goal.

It's his lack of doing absolutely anything that pisses me off.

If he is insistent on going to ground, which he shouldn't be doing, then get a result out of it.

I'm really not arsed if that means a foul and a red card when it prevents a goal.

What made his senseless action worse was that it left Fernandinho havign to try to cover the man with the ball, forcing him to leave Traore open. If Otamendi stays on his feet and tries to shepherd his man out wide or slow him down. Fern is still able to cover Traore.

Last year Van Dijk didn't get injured. That was where Liverpool were lucky. However, Gomez was on a great run then broke his leg against Burnley. Lovren proceeded to get injured and then Matip which left Liverpool shoehorning Fabinho in as a Centre Back for a few weeks.
Laporte is class and was a leader at the back. Once injured coupled with Kompany leaving things were going to be a bit shaky there. Norwich really exposed City and highlighted Laporte's absence but still had to score 3 to win. Against Wolves I'm not sure what happened. Granted, the defence was all over the place but it doesn't explain why there were no goals the other end. KDB was missing and is also world class but he was missing for most of last season and that had f-all impact.
